Professional Excavation Services in South Waikato

South Waikato, with its diverse mix of heritage homes and modernist architectural styles, often presents unique challenges when it comes to construction projects. If you’re planning on starting a renovation or new construction project, finding the right excavation contractor is crucial. Experienced and reviewed excavation professionals can ensure your project begins on a solid foundation, quite literally. Their ability to operate heavy machinery and interpret site plans makes them indispensable in the initial stages of your construction work.

Importance of Site Assessment

Before any digging begins, a thorough site assessment is essential. You should ask your contractor if they conduct these evaluations to identify any potential obstacles or hazards. From buried utility lines to hard rock formations, these factors can significantly impact how and when your excavation work can proceed. In a region like South Waikato, with its unique soil composition and geothermal activity, a pre-work site assessment by an expert can help avert any unexpected challenges that could delay your project.

Weather Considerations

Weather plays a significant role in the progress of excavation projects. South Waikato’s windy conditions, especially during the spring, and its relatively warm summers require contractors to adapt their schedules and strategies accordingly. High winds can spread dust and rain can cause soil erosion, complicating your project. An experienced contractor should account for these variables to minimise disruptions and ensure safety and environmental protections are in place.

Certified and Qualified Professionals

One of the key aspects of selecting an excavation contractor is ensuring they’re both certified and experienced. You may want to ask if they possess credentials such as a National Certificate in Civil Engineering - Construction (Level 4) and if they are members of any professional organisations like Civil Contractors New Zealand (CCNZ). These credentials can indicate a robust understanding of construction techniques and professional standards, providing you peace of mind that your project may be handled proficiently.

Equipment Reliability and Safety

The ability to operate he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and dump trucks is essential for any excavation project. It’s just as important that this machinery is well-maintained and operated safely. Trustworthy contractors should ensure their equipment is regularly serviced and their operations might meet rigorous safety standards. You should discuss their approach to health and safety to maximise efficiency and minimise the risk of accidents.
